How do you find the concentrations of the Blank and Working Standards 1-3?
Concentration of Stock Standard Solution (Stock SS): 100 mu g/mL Concentration of Stock Internal Standard Solution (Stock ISS): 100 mu g/mL Working Standards: The Blank Solution was prepared by adding 250 mu L of the Stock ISS into a glass vial containing 4.75 mL of methanol, the diluent. Shake to mix well. Working Standard Solution #1 was prepared by adding 100 mu L of the Stock S5 and 250 mu L of the Stock ISS into a glass vial containing 4.65 mL of methanol. Shake to mix well. Working Standard Solution #2 was prepared by adding 250 mu L of the Stock S5 and 250 mu L of the Stock ISS into a glass vial containing 4.5 mL of methanol. Shake to mix well. Working Standard Solution #3 was prepared by adding 500 mu L of the Stock S5 and 250 mu L of the Stock ISS into a glass vial containing 4.25 mL of methanol. Shake to mix well. The submitted Test Samples were prepared by taking 100 mu L of the solution and diluting it to 5 mL with methanol. Then, these prepared Test Sample Solutions were diluted 100X by adding 50 mu L to 5 mL of methanol. The solutions were run in duplicate.Explanation / Answer
a) The concentration of stock ISS is 100 micro gram/ ml ,so in 250 microitre it will be 25 microgram and it will be in total volume of 5ml.So ,the concentrstion 0f ISS is 25×1000/5×1000 = 5 mg/litre.
b)ISS amount is 25 microgram as calculated above and it is total volume of 5ml ( .1 ml + .25ml + 4.65ml ) Therefore ISS concentration is 5mg /litre
Stock SS concentration is 100 micro gram / ml. So , in 100 micro litre i.e 0.1ml the amount is 10microlitre and it will be in the total volume of 5ml ,So the SS concentration is 10×1000/5×1000 = 2mg/litre
c)ISS concentration is 5 mg litre as calculated above .
SS amount in 250 micro litre is 25 micro gram and this amount is in the total volume of 5ml , so the concentrayion is 25×1000/5×1000 = 5 mg/litre.
d) ISS contration is same as calculated and it is 5mg/litre
500 microlitre of SS contain 50 micro gram of SS and it is in total volume of 5 ml, so the concentration of SS is 50×1000/5×1000 = 10 mg/ litre
